Pause the storefront without losing the workday
Maintenance mode gives a site a deliberate public state for launches, catalog changes, migrations, and planned infrastructure work. Enable the module, turn on the master switch, and public storefront routes show a themed maintenance page instead of a half-finished shopping experience.
The gate covers the catalog, product and collection pages, cart, checkout, and customer account routes. Dashboard users can continue working normally, and a validated builder preview can still inspect the rest of the storefront.
Make the message feel like your storefront
The settings page keeps the content practical and editable: a title, description, searchable Lucide icon, and a list of buttons. Button entries have their own label, destination, style, and delete action, so the page can point shoppers to a homepage, support page, social profile, or another safe resource.
Only internal paths and http or https URLs are accepted. Unsafe schemes such
as javascript: and data: are rejected at the server boundary.
Schedule a controlled maintenance window
Use Until turned off for an immediate pause, or choose a scheduled window with inclusive start and end times. Stoify stores these values as UTC because sites do not currently have a timezone setting; the dashboard labels that boundary directly beside the controls.
The schedule applies only while the master module toggle is enabled. A future window leaves the storefront open until its start, and an ended window returns the site to its normal routes automatically.
Preview before you publish the pause
When the Maintenance Mode module is enabled, the storefront builder adds a dedicated Maintenance page surface. It uses the same theme as the live storefront and provides an inspector for the exact content saved in Settings. You can edit and review the page even while the master switch is off, then save with the same builder history and preview flow used by other surfaces.
